Thin Film Resistor Chips Offer T Reliability Level

Oct. 25, 2010
Vishay extends its E/H MIL-PRF-55342-qualified thin-film, surface-mount resistor chips in the 0505, 1005, 1505, 0705, 1206, and 1010 case sizes to offer a "T" reliability level for space applications.

Qualification on larger cases sizes is pending. The resistors were verified in qualification for the American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M E-595) standard test method for total mass loss and collected volatile condensable materials from outgassing in a vacuum environment. Other features include a passivated Nichrome resistive element, power ratings to 500 mW, a noise figure of less than -25 dB, low voltage coefficient of less than 0.1 ppm/V, absolute TCRs down to ± 25 ppm/°C, tolerances down to 0.1 %, and a resistance range from 10 Ω to 1.69 MΩ depending on case size and characteristics. Pricing ranges from $5 to $15 per piece. VISHAY INTERTECHNOLOGY, INC., Malvern, PA. (619) 336-0860.
